Sizzix Tree Step-ups Card & Sizzix Gift Fold-it Die Sets – The Stamps of Life
Hello! I’d love to share with you today a few cards that I made using some newly released Sizzix products. Although they have been available on the Sizzix website for the past few months, they were just released this morning…
Read More »